Allcargo Terminals Limited shared its Q4 & FY25 investor presentation. FY25 revenue grew 3% YoY to Rs 758 Cr, EBITDA rose about 10% to Rs 128 Cr, but PAT declined 32% to Rs 30 Cr due to a one-off Rs 9.7 Cr tax provision and other exceptional costs. Q4 FY25 saw strong EBITDA growth of 26% YoY to Rs 34 Cr on Rs 186 Cr revenue. CFS volumes for FY25 grew 1% to 620,756 TEUs, with EBITDA per TEU improving 8%. The company augmented capacity by 29% through JNPT and Mundra expansion, made a strategic Rs 115 Cr investment in HORCL to tap the NCR market via the Dedicated Freight Corridor, and increased its stake in Speedy Multimodes to 100%.

Likely market impact

Margin trajectory is encouraging with EBITDA per TEU rising 8% and utilization around 90%, but the sharp PAT drop may temper near-term sentiment. The multi-year aspiration to double profitability and handle 1 million TEUs by FY2027-28, backed by ~65% planned capacity addition, signals confidence in long-term growth.
